THE WAY TO WONDERLAND

Info


Ever imagined that you could travel into Wonderland within seconds and return to this "damn basic" place called Earth within the next few seconds? Some of you must be trying to figure out what I actually mean by this. The Wonderland is your state of mind where your happiness knows no bounds and you're in a state of sheer ecstasy. Whereas,Earth is the Reality where things are practical and in most cases disappointing. Honestly,we stay on Earth more than in Wonderland,that is, we face reality more often than we take a trip to the land of happiness. Hence, I say happiness is a bad habit. Staying happy is a bad habit because the day you're pulled back to this Earth you cannot ever escape back to Wonderland.

I am sure that all of you are thinking that I am some kind of a pessimist or loner. But mind you, I am not. I try too; looking at the brighter side of things but somehow I am never able to see it completely. It maybe because I am unfortunate or haven't come across the perfect events in life. Still,I would like to debate on the happiness of the "alleged happy people".
So what gives you people happiness? Jewellery,money,clothes,friends? Or smile,mental peace,zero worries,fresh air?
Most of you are going to choose the first option out of an impulse,I know. But give it a second thought;that whether having lots of money and worrying about making more is better than having no money,no worries and waking up with a smile every morning? We human beings have adopted a "materialistic happiness" and have lost our rationality to such extent that we are unable to see that we are already happy and that these "superficial objects" namely wealth and tangible goods juxtaposed, are suppressing it.

Many of you are thinking that I am a fool because money is everything today and no money is equivalent to no life. But think about people in the primeval times. They ate a meal cooked on three stones,they looked after their families,had shelters, and above all had happiness. Think about the Jarwaa tribes in Andaman,the last time I visited their area I saw their eyes shining bright with happiness and their lips having the brightest smiles. My argument here is to make you believe that the more you have the less happy you are. I firmly adhere to the Buddhist saying that our wants are the sole cause of our suffering. I am not asking anyone to give up your wealth or items of pleasure, all I am asking for is to allay your materialistic approach and try to settle for less at times. It does more good than harm as you become equipped to both manage with little as well as to efficiently channelise the excess.

Having less in life actually allows you to have a prolonged trip in the Wonderland whereas having more at times even doesn't allow you to board the flight to Wonderland. People actually need to be more acquainted with the difference between pleasure and happiness. For example: Biriyani gives you supposed happiness and fills your hungry stomach. But a bowl of boiled rice too cures your hunger. Biriyani is your want and boiled rice is your need. Both serve the same purpose just one gives more "pleasure" than the other. Therefore, our want serves pleasure and not happiness. The day when we learn to differentiate between want and need, pleasure and happiness; we shall all get boarding passes for the flight to Wonderland.

This fancy dogma of happiness based of materialism is created by us. The kind of monetary happiness we believe in; is basically to please the society by living up to their definition of an "elite status". The life given to us is not meant for pleasing the society and their members. Therefore, we can find happiness in the most tiny objects for pleasing our ownselves. Happiness lies within us, we will surely find it the day we learn to allay our demands and wants.

A minimalistic approach can convert your bad habit,namely happiness into the best habit.The proper reasoning to understand that pleasure or luxury is not synonymous to happiness is the wonderdust we need; to reach Wonderland. Let us all try to create this wonderdust and reach the Wonderland that awaits us.
